Meet our December Client Spotlight, Ziti!

Ziti is a 1 year old Plott Hound who lives in Northeast Ohio with her parents, Helaina and Jeremy. Ziti came to Anthony in July of this year to address reactivity, build engagement, reduce dog reactivity, and overall have a better relationship. Helaina said her favorite thing about Ziti is her unique brindle markings, along with how much fun it is to train Ziti.

The most valuable thing Ziti’s parents have learned throughout training is the importance of a solid foundation. Building the foundation allows the dog and handler to build trust and reliability, which can be used to add in more distractions, triggers, and experiences later. If you set your dog up for success in the beginning you can push them later as you grow together. Helaina, Jeremy, and Ziti continue to work on heel and dog reactivity. The more consistent they are with exposing Ziti to dogs in a productive and safe way, the less reactive Ziti is when she encounters them on walks.

“It’s so rewarding to see the massive improvement in only a few months. It really makes all the hours of work worth it. Having a well trained dog isn’t just rewarding for us. Ziti has less anxiety, is more attentive, and her confidence grows every day because of the work and guidance Anthony and the whole team puts in to what they do best. It’s the best decision we made for our family and our girl, Ziti. Thank you!”

Happy 6th Birthday to us!

Yesterday we hosted one of our typical Sunday pack walks, but it felt a little different. For starters, six years ago pack walks were held indoors, but at a completely different space that we rented out for pack walks only. No training took place in that space - just people hanging out, training their dogs, and creating the foundation to a bigger community.

The following year we moved into our first training center off State and Cypress where the indoor walks unfortunately came to an end due to size constraints. During our time there we hosted an open house, built meaningful relationships with clients and their dogs, met some clients turned best friends, continued to build our dog training knowledge, navigated a new business during COVID shut downs, fostered a few dogs, and brought our first apprentice on.

Fast forward to yesterday, we realized that two of the people at the pack walk were two clients (turned employees) that were there from the very start at the original building, our then apprentice is now one of our full-time dog trainers, and we had two clients that made the move with us from the old building to our new space. We also had a former board and train (a service only offered in the new space), along with a person who was joining us for their first pack walk.

Yesterday’s pack walk was a full circle moment of all the changes we’ve undergone over the last six years, and how the best of clients and friends remained with us through it all. We appreciate every client and dog that has stepped through our doors, anyone that has taken the time to recommend us to family, friends, or strangers, those that have taken the time to leave a review, and our repeat clients that keep showing up for us year after year. It doesn’t matter if you met us six years ago or six weeks ago, we’re happy to have you here with us.

Our November Client Spotlight is joining us for boarding over the holiday! 🍗

Meet Otis Dortmunder, a 2.5 year old Pitbull Mix who lives in Cleveland with his parents, Jen and Ryan. Otis came to us for training in August because his mom was becoming frustrated with some of his behavior on leash. Otis was sound sensitive on walks, would often lay down and “pancake” on walks when passing another dog, and needed some help cleaning up heel. At the assessment we noticed that Otis was lacking confidence, which made living in a city more of a challenge for him.

Jen mentioned her biggest goal for training was to boost Otis’ confidence so he could calmly pass dogs on walks without laying down. Walks used to take a significant amount of time because Otis would spend a good chunk pancaked to the sidewalk. Otis and his parents continue to work on his leash drills, their leash handling, and helping Otis find his calm through long downs and place. When Otis isn’t training he can be found snuggled up with mom.

The most valuable thing Jen learned during training was how to better navigate the environment through better leash handling, allowing her to guide Otis through his uncertainty. “Turning Point and Paige have been great! Otis’s walks are so much more enjoyable for him and for us! We are very grateful!”
